use std::net::{IpAddr, Ipv4Addr};
use brocade::{BrocadeOptions, Vlan, ssh};
use harmony_secret::{Secret, SecretManager};
use harmony_types::switch::PortLocation;
use schemars::JsonSchema;
use serde::{Deserialize, Serialize};
#[derive(Secret, Clone, Debug, JsonSchema, Serialize, Deserialize)]
struct BrocadeSwitchAuth {
username: String,
password: String,
}
#[tokio::main]
async fn main() {
env_logger::Builder::from_env(env_logger::Env::default().default_filter_or("info")).init();
// let ip = IpAddr::V4(Ipv4Addr::new(10, 0, 0, 250)); // old brocade @ ianlet
// let ip = IpAddr::V4(Ipv4Addr::new(127, 0, 0, 1)); // brocade @ sto1
// let ip = IpAddr::V4(Ipv4Addr::new(192, 168, 4, 11)); // brocade @ st
//let switch_addresses = vec![ip];
let ip0 = IpAddr::V4(Ipv4Addr::new(192, 168, 12, 147)); // brocade @ test
let ip1 = IpAddr::V4(Ipv4Addr::new(192, 168, 12, 109)); // brocade @ test
let switch_addresses = vec![ip0, ip1];
let config = SecretManager::get_or_prompt::<BrocadeSwitchAuth>()
.await
.unwrap();
let brocade = brocade::init(
&switch_addresses,
&config.username,
&config.password,
&BrocadeOptions {
dry_run: true,
ssh: ssh::SshOptions {
port: 22,
..Default::default()
},
..Default::default()
},
)
.await
.expect("Brocade client failed to connect");
let entries = brocade.get_stack_topology().await.unwrap();
println!("Stack topology: {entries:#?}");
let entries = brocade.get_interfaces().await.unwrap();
println!("Interfaces: {entries:#?}");
let version = brocade.version().await.unwrap();
println!("Version: {version:?}");
println!("--------------");
let mac_adddresses = brocade.get_mac_address_table().await.unwrap();
println!("VLAN\tMAC\t\t\tPORT");
for mac in mac_adddresses {
println!("{}\t{}\t{}", mac.vlan, mac.mac_address, mac.port);
}
println!("--------------");
println!("Creating VLAN 100 (test-vlan)...");
brocade
.create_vlan(&Vlan {
id: 100,
name: "test-vlan".to_string(),
})
.await
.unwrap();
println!("--------------");
println!("Deleting VLAN 100...");
brocade
.delete_vlan(&Vlan {
id: 100,
name: "test-vlan".to_string(),
})
.await
.unwrap();
println!("--------------");
